Nigeria Mixed Martial Arts Federation President Tasks Newly-Elected Rivers Swan Exco To Take Association To Apex

The President of Nigeria Mixed Martial Arts Federation, NMMAF, Ambassador Henry George has charged the newly-elected executive council of the Sports Writers Association of Nigeria, SWAN Rivers State Chapter to take the Association to greater heights.

Speaking to Nigeria Mixed Martial Arts Federation Media, George said the Association under the leadership of seasoned journalist Udede Jim-Opiki, must strive to do better in all aspects and inculcate combat Sports in its programs.

“We want to say congratulations to the new executives, the executives should have in mind that we have entrusted them the task of taking the association to greater heights.

He added, “from our own end combat sports, we want to see them look more at combat sports news because a lot is happening in the world of combat sports. It is a new start for Swan Rivers State Chapter, on behalf of the Nigeria Mix Martial Arts Federation, I want to say congratulations to the newly-elected Swan Chairman and his exco, congratulations.

Other officers elected were Sarah David as Vice Chairman, Chukwudi Ejimofor, General Secretary, Wokoma-Solomon Innocent Treasurer, and Barth Ndubuwah, emerged Financial Secretary.
